"Kitchen Dangers Exposed: Unhealthy Cooking Methods to Avoid. A new report highlights the four most common cooking methods that can have devastating effects on our health. Deep-frying, a staple in many fast-food chains, is known to increase the risk of heart disease due to its high calorie and fat content. Charcoal grilling, while popular for its smoky flavor, can lead to the formation of carcinogenic compounds when meat is cooked at high temperatures. Meanwhile, pan-frying at extremely high temperatures can also lead to the formation of these cancer-causing substances, and microwaving in plastic containers can leach chemicals into food, posing a risk to our overall well-being.
